What is Cast Iron Investment Casting?

 

Cast iron investment casting is a process where cast iron is melted and poured into a ceramic mould that has been shaped from a wax model. This technique is part of the broader category of investment casting but specifically utilizes cast iron—a material known for its excellent fluidity, castability, and machinability. The process begins with the creation of a wax model of the desired part, which is then encased in a ceramic slurry. Once the ceramic is hardened and the wax melted out, molten cast iron is poured into the cavity, forming a precise replica of the original model upon solidification. The mould is then destroyed to retrieve the cast, resulting in a high-precision component.

 

 

Properties of Cast Iron Suitable for Investment Casting

 

Cast iron, with its various alloys and grades, is particularly suitable for investment casting due to several inherent properties:

·         Wear Resistance: Cast iron is highly resistant to wear and abrasion, which makes it an ideal choice for parts that must withstand harsh operational conditions, such as gears and pistons.

·         Excellent Machinability: Despite its hardness, cast iron is easier to machine compared to many other metals, allowing for finer finishes and precision in the final product.

·         Vibration Damping: One of the standout properties of cast iron is its ability to dampen vibrations, making it perfect for applications involving moving parts and machinery.

·         Types of Cast Iron: The main types used in investment casting include:

·         Grey Cast Iron: Characterized by its graphite flake structure, which provides good thermal conductivity and specific mechanical properties ideal for engine blocks and machine bases.

·         Ductile Cast Iron: Known for its strength and ductility, which are crucial for components subjected to high stress such as automotive components and large industrial machinery.

·         Malleable Cast Iron: Exhibits excellent tensile strength and shock resistance, suitable for small parts like brackets and fasteners where toughness is required.

·         White Cast Iron: Hard and brittle, it is generally used where hardness is more critical than tensile strength, such as in wear-resistant surfaces.

·         Compacted Graphite Iron: Offers higher thermal conductivity, good fatigue resistance, and strength between grey and ductile iron, useful in automotive and heavy-duty applications.

Each type of cast iron brings specific advantages to the casting process, allowing manufacturers to choose the most appropriate material based on the performance requirements of the final product. This versatility, coupled with the economic benefits of cast iron, makes investment casting a preferred technique in various sectors of the manufacturing industry.

 

Advantages of Cast Iron Investment Casting

 

Cast iron investment casting offers numerous benefits that make it a favoured choice in many industrial applications:

·         Durability: Cast iron parts are exceptionally durable, able to withstand heavy loads and high stresses, making them ideal for the demanding conditions of industrial machinery and automotive components.

·         Cost-Effectiveness: Compared to other metals, cast iron is relatively inexpensive and widely available. The investment casting process further enhances this cost-effectiveness by producing near-net-shape parts that require minimal machining and finishing, thus saving on material costs and reducing waste.

·         Design Flexibility: Investment casting allows for the creation of complex shapes and intricate details that would be difficult or impossible to achieve with other manufacturing processes. This capability is particularly useful in producing ornate patterns and components with internal features.

·         Excellent Surface Finish: Cast iron investment castings typically have an excellent surface finish, reducing the need for additional surface treatment processes and thereby lowering production costs.

 

Applications of Cast Iron Investment Casting

 

The versatility of cast iron investment casting makes it suitable for a wide range of applications across various industries:

·         Automotive Industry:  Components such as engine blocks, cylinder heads, and brake parts are commonly produced using cast iron investment casting due to the material's strength and wear resistance.

·         Construction Equipment: Cast iron parts such as hydraulic components, valves, and various housing parts are crucial in heavy machinery for construction due to their durability and robustness.

·         Agricultural Machinery: Investment cast iron is used in the manufacture of tractor parts, planting and harvesting equipment components, and other heavy-duty Machinery Parts that require high strength and resistance to wear.

·         Railway and Shipping:  Cast iron investment casting is used to create parts for railway track equipment, engine components for ships, and other high-strength applications in transport infrastructure.
